Output 536891bda3ac0c3ec781274a8f17c85a9631c024c9e59adff7dfd5828b679382:0

value
22242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88ddfd67bc123192be5b5c5af58db61f04f9ae3 OP_EQUAL
address
3KyT2Wk8c9PVcnzfZsMyxPXaz7i2DpuFMP
transaction
536891bda3ac0c3ec781274a8f17c85a9631c024c9e59adff7dfd5828b679382
confirmations
369329
spent
true